The University of Virginia’s Medical Services, a unit within the Department of Student Health and Wellness, is seeking a Registered Nurse 3.

Registered Nurse 3 employees plan and provide professional nursing services and patient care in outpatient settings. They ensure compliance with physician orders and follow established nursing processes, including patient assessment, nursing diagnosis, planning, intervention, and evaluation. They exercise judgment and decision making in their daily work. Work is somewhat independent and performed according to established protocols. Registered Nurse 3 employees perform much of the same work as Registered Nurse 2 employees with more experience, an increased level of competency, more complex assigned tasks, and the ability to lead a team.

Responsibilities include:

  • Assess patients using nursing skills to evaluate vital signs, breath sounds, and any specific observations needed.
  • Perform specific therapeutic interventions that assist medical evaluation.
  • Read and synthesize information from patients' files, which may include medical histories, prescribed medications, vital sign readings, and clinical observations, to learn about patients' conditions, determine patients' care priorities, and prepare test requisitions according to physicians' specifications.
  • Communicate patient status and changes in patient condition as appropriate, and collaborate with nursing supervisor to address complex issues.
  • Serve as a coordinator for a specific nurse clinic
  • In addition to the above job responsibilities, other duties may be assigned.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Education: Graduation from an accredited School of Nursing, Bachelor's of Science degree, or Associate's Degree in Nursing

  • Experience: Five years of experience as an RN.

  • Licensure: Licensed to Practice as a Registered Nurse in the Commonwealth of Virginia. American Heart Association (AHA) Health Care Provider BLS certification required.
